
COLUMBUS, Ohio — Ohio State basketball closed out the non-conference portion of its schedule with an 83-37 win over IUPUI on Thursday night. The Buckeyes rushed out to a 9-0 lead early and never trailed in the contest, even if it went through various scoring droughts throughout the first half. Despite clearly being the superior team, they took just a 13 point lead into halftime courtesy of a 7-2 run to close out the half. OSU came out of the break with more juice, once again getting off to a hot start while the Jaguar struggled to generate offense or get stops defensively. A reasonable deficit quickly turned into a 22-point lead by the first media time out of the first half after OSU made all but one of its first six shots.
